Importance of Solidity Audits: Smart contracts are immutable once deployed on the blockchain, making thorough code review and auditing essential before deployment. Solidity audits play a crucial role in identifying potential risks such as reentrancy attacks, integer overflows, and logic errors. By conducting audits, developers can ensure that smart contracts function as intended and withstand potential exploits. This proactive approach to security helps safeguard the integrity of blockchain projects and protects stakeholders from potential risks.
